CLEAR ANSWERS TO COMMON QUESTIONS

Frequently Asked Questions

What does this quiz assess?
It measures recognition and understanding of connective tissue structures in histology. Items cover cells, fibers, ground substance, cartilage, bone, and tissue organization.
How many questions are included and how long does it take?
The quiz includes 16 questions. Typical completion time is about 10 minutes.
What types of questions are used?
Questions use specimen-style descriptions and ask for interpretation of microscopic features and their functions. Some items require distinguishing between commonly confused tissue types.
How are results reported?
Results are provided as a score-band summary of current knowledge. The summary is intended for practice and review rather than diagnostic decisions.
Is registration required and is there a cost?
No sign-up is required. The quiz is available at no cost.
